Output 74697c837f622f6d02c922d1e90f2ba2a0ec3b1b6f2be0c19bdae0fb1d89910e:0

value
319292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e542b99fe2500d92fda0dd919b8ad17ef1e9334e OP_EQUAL
address
3NbEbcZGwTSuYR7DMairGnmXTgKLwem94o
transaction
74697c837f622f6d02c922d1e90f2ba2a0ec3b1b6f2be0c19bdae0fb1d89910e
spent
true